Things To Do

Top Activity 1: Village Cultural Experiences Most cruise visits include guided time in local villages, where residents share traditional dances, songs, and customs. These experiences are led by the community and emphasize respect and storytelling. Guests often learn about daily life, family structures, and how traditions have been passed down through generations, creating a meaningful cultural exchange.

Top Activity 2: Coastal Walks and Beach Time Walking along the shoreline reveals Ambrym's dramatic character, with black sand beaches, scattered driftwood, and wide ocean views. The pace is slow and reflective, allowing time to appreciate the sound of the sea and the island's natural rhythm. Swimming may be possible depending on conditions, but observation and atmosphere are the real highlights.

Lesser Known Gem: Local Storytelling Moments One of the most rewarding parts of a visit is listening to elders share stories about the island, its spirits, and its history. These conversations often happen informally and provide insight into beliefs and values that guide community life. They add depth to everything you see around you.

Cruise Port Information

Ambrym Island does not have a large port facility, and cruise ships typically anchor offshore. Passengers are brought ashore by tender, often greeted by villagers near the landing area. Shore activities are generally organized through the ship in partnership with local communities, as independent transport options are limited. Facilities are simple, and the experience is intentionally low impact. The focus is on respectful interaction and preserving the character of the island rather than accommodating large crowds.
